Transaction ec314c1a7259cf69aaee2705c193f60f7fdecbc47f06f34ee919a5fec4051ace
1 Input
1 Output
-
ec314c1a7259cf69aaee2705c193f60f7fdecbc47f06f34ee919a5fec4051ace:0
- value
- 1239582
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 15a750552a20f2924b6353a8240bff5008a662a2 OP_EQUAL
- address
- 33fWYjoXY5BVwvq3KfJ2Wzy47MQDuvht3Q